Transaction 85e1399fdc4b80c5c8b7fcc6699bd12f8ebe0d05b3a99366bccbae2165ee03fd

18 Input
2 Outputs
  • 85e1399fdc4b80c5c8b7fcc6699bd12f8ebe0d05b3a99366bccbae2165ee03fd:0
  • value  985015
    address  33Ddm1tDqfnvxtH57XSbao67NBMtdFt48E
  • 85e1399fdc4b80c5c8b7fcc6699bd12f8ebe0d05b3a99366bccbae2165ee03fd:1
  • value  61697
    address  18wY6Cugpt8uhA9dgE81iqXwX4X5PYYKuV